Radiopharmaceutical Management: Prepare, measure, and administer radioactive isotopes/drugs to patients via injection, ingestion, or inhalation.
Imaging & Diagnostics: Operate cameras and scanners (PET, SPECT) to create diagnostic images of organs and tissues.
Patient Care: Explain procedures to patients, address concerns, ensure comfort, and monitor vital signs during scans.
Safety & Compliance: Adhere to safety standards for radiation exposure for patients, staff, and visitors.
Data Processing: Analyze and process images for interpretation by radiologists or nuclear medicine physicians.
Quality Control: Calibrate and perform quality checks on equipment to ensure accuracy.
